Network Performance Optimization

Network Performance Optimization is a set of techniques and practices aimed at improving the speed, reliability, and efficiency of data transmission across computer networks. It involves analyzing network traffic, identifying bottlenecks, and implementing solutions to reduce latency, increase throughput, and minimize packet loss. This is critical for ensuring optimal user experience in applications like web services, video streaming, and real-time communications.

🧊Why learn Network Performance Optimization?

Developers should learn this to build high-performance applications that deliver fast response times and handle high traffic loads, especially for latency-sensitive services like online gaming, financial trading, or video conferencing. It's essential when scaling systems, reducing operational costs, or meeting service-level agreements (SLAs) in cloud or distributed environments.
